Margin-Top が Firefox のインライン要素に影響しないのはなぜですか?

DDD
リリース: 2024-11-17 12:30:02
オリジナル
427 人が閲覧しました

Why Doesn't Margin-Top Affect Inline Elements in Firefox?

Firefox のインライン要素における Margin Top の無効性

Margin Top プロパティを設定しても、Firefox のインライン要素に影響を与えないのはなぜなのか疑問に思われるかもしれません。この動作は Firefox に限定されたものではなく、CSS 2.1 仕様の一部として定義されていることを明確にすることが重要です。

CSS 2.1 仕様によれば、マージン関連のプロパティは要素のマージン領域の幅を決定します。通常、これらはすべての要素に適用されますが、margin-top などの垂直マージンは、置換されていないインライン要素には影響しません。

これは、margin-top スタイルを

に適用する場合を意味します。または <スパン>インライン要素とみなされる要素は、margin-top 設定を無視し、垂直方向のマージン スペースなしでレンダリングされます。

以上がMargin-Top が Firefox のインライン要素に影響しないの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ート